Downloading torrents provides an effective method for sharing and accessing large files such as movies, music, and software. Nonetheless, it carries risks, including malware, legal complications, and the exposure of your IP address. This guide details how to torrent safely and anonymously.

1. Use a VPN to Conceal Your IP Address

A VPN hides your IP address, stopping others in the torrent swarm from identifying you. It also secures your traffic against monitoring by your ISP or network administrator. Always keep your VPN activated when using a torrent client to prevent revealing your actual IP address.

2. Choose a Secure Torrent Client

Not every torrent client is the same. Select one that is free of ads, bloatware, and security flaws. Configure your client by activating IP binding, which guarantees torrents only download while connected to designated IPs, similar to a VPN kill switch.

3. Visit Reliable Torrent Websites

Many torrent sites contain fake links and harmful files. Stick to reputable sources and verify user comments to ensure the file's safety. Utilize antivirus software with real-time monitoring to block harmful sites and files.

4. Download Trusted Torrents

Always confirm the source of torrents. Look for trusted user badges on torrent sites and avoid files with unknown extensions. High-speed torrents are typically safer, but be wary of exceedingly popular files that might attract legal attention.

5. Install Antivirus Software

Scan all downloaded files to identify malware, spyware, or ransomware. Schedule routine scans and activate real-time protection to safeguard your device while torrenting.

Configuring Your VPN for Torrenting

To ensure maximum security, connect to P2P-friendly servers, enable kill switch and leak protection features, and employ secure protocols like WireGuard or OpenVPN. Avoid using insecure protocols like PPTP and keep your IP concealed.

Setting Up Your Torrent Client

Install a reliable client, activate automatic updates, and disable automatic startup. Use IP binding to halt torrenting if your VPN disconnects, and routinely check for leaks to confirm your IP remains concealed.

Safely Opening .torrent Files

Torrent files instruct your client to download and upload files but can reveal your IP. Always use a VPN when torrenting and verify file contents prior to opening, especially if the file format appears suspicious.

Risks of Torrenting

  • Malware and Viruses: Torrent files might harbor harmful software. Utilize antivirus software and download exclusively from trustworthy sources.
  • Legal Issues: Sharing copyrighted content is illegal and can result in fines or other repercussions. Avoid illegal torrents and websites.
  • Hackers: Your exposed IP might be targeted by hackers for scams or attacks. Utilize a VPN to obscure your IP.
  • ISP Throttling: ISPs may reduce your connection speed if they detect torrenting. Encrypt your traffic to circumvent throttling.
